The Santa Monica History Museum will host a pop-up Día de los Muertos exhibition starting November 1, showcasing altars created by public high school students from Santa Monica, Venice, University, and Fairfax High Schools. The event will feature mariachi music, traditional dancers, and opportunities for visitors to add photos of loved ones to the altars, fostering community remembrance. Evening programming on November 1 and 2 begins at 5:00 PM, celebrating life and legacy through culture, history, and art.
